Lewiston-Porter High School has been approved for a Confucius Classroom, the only one in Niagara County. The classroom comes after five years of work through the University at Buffalo's Confucius Institute and the Chinese government agency HANBAN. It is also an extension of more than 20 years of international studies programming at Lew-Port.

With the Sept. 10 primary looming around the corner, the Niagara County Republican Committee issued a statement this week with regard to the race for supervisor in the Town of Lewiston.
Over past weeks, reports surfaced that both incumbent Steve Reiter and current Town Councilman Ernest Palmer secured sufficient numbers of voter signatures on petitions to enable their candidacy in the Sept. 10 primary on the GOP line.
However, the Niagara County Republican Committee has opted to remain in the background - until this week, announcing that it has decided to come out in support of Palmer in the primary.
